How to specify a non default type when calling a FFmpeg library using ctypes
1er août 2013, par Jim RambergI am calling an FFMPEG library called avformat_alloc_context() that returns a pointer to type AVFormatContext. The structure AVFormatContext is defined in the avformat library.
Obviously ; this is not one ctypes default types and results in an error when I try to pass a reference to it to another ffmpeg library further down in my code.
Is there a way to add in the the classes defined inside of the library ? I read through what documentation I could find online and was not able to find a good answer to this question.

how to use ffmpeg with mjpeg_vaapi encoder (with hardware acceleration) ?
8 août 2018, par MaratWhen I use ffmpeg with mjpeg encoder without hardware acceleration, everything works fine. I use following command :
ffmpeg -nostdin -rtsp_transport udp_multicast -allowed_media_types 'video' -i 'rtsp://MYIP' -ss 00:00:0.00 -f image2pipe -q:v 24 -vf scale=-2:480,format=yuv420p -c:v mjpeg -vframes 1 pipe:1
But, when I try to use mjpeg with hardware acceleration, I always get error :
ffmpeg -nostdin -rtsp_transport udp_multicast -allowed_media_types 'video' -hwaccel vaapi -vaapi_device /dev/dri/renderD128 -hwaccel_output_format vaapi -i 'rtsp://MYIP' -ss 00:00:0.00 -f image2pipe -q:v 24 -vf scale=-2:480,format=yuv420p -c:v mjpeg_vaapi -vframes 1 pipe:1
